A scenario analyzed in Europe suggests that defending NATO's Eastern Flank without U.S. military support would require significant resources, including 200,000 troops and 1,500 tanks. The Baltic region is identified as a critical area, with Romania and the Baltic states on the frontline. The analysis highlights the need for European autonomy in defense, especially given uncertainties about U.S. involvement. Potential Russian tactics could include missile and drone attacks, cyber operations, and sabotage. The logistics of deploying European forces would be challenging, emphasizing the importance of rapid response in the initial days of conflict. Overall, Europe must enhance its military capabilities to compensate for the absence of U.S. support.
